Böhönye is a village in Somogy county, Hungary.

The settlement is part of the Balatonboglár wine region.[2]

Etymology

Its name derives from the given name Buhun which got an suffix which meant, in the form Buhuné, that the village belonged to him.[3]

History

Böhönye is a settlement dating from at least 1536, when it was first seen in historical records [1][permanent dead link].
